Part Details | HIGH PASS FILTER

5915-01-156-5703 An item designed to pass all frequencies above a specified frequency. Excludes a single inductance, a single capacitance, or a single resistance. See COIL (as modified); REACTOR; CAPACITOR (as modified); and RESISTOR (as modified).
